Method
Transdermal or patch testing is carried out using USP method 5 (paddle over disc) or USP method 6, the rotating cylinder.
With paddle over disc, the transdermal patch is placed between a glass disc and an inert PTFE mesh. This is placed at the bottom of the vessel, with the mesh facing upwards, under a rotating paddle.
Unlike dissolution testing, transdermal testing is carried out at 32°C to reflect the lower temperature of the skin. Other variables such as the height setting and sampling requirements are the same as dissolution testing.
